Locanda di San Martino Review

Combining good taste, agreeable surroundings, and excellent value, the Locanda is a prime place to stay among Matera's Sassi. The historic rooms—formerly cave dwellings—have been impeccably restored under the guidance of owner Antonio Panetta and Dorothy Zinn. An elevator whisks you to your floor, and a short walk outdoors takes you to your room. Stepping out onto your terrace overlooking the old town is like being on a movie set. What was once an old cistern has now been turned into an indoor swimming pool with a sauna.
